如何配置bond0网卡
介绍
网卡是服务器的重要组成部分之一,bond0是一种网络适配器绑定技术,它可以将多张物理网卡进行绑定,从而提高服务器的网络传输速度和安全性。
配置bond0网卡的步骤
1.安装绑定驱动
首先需要通过命令行安装绑定驱动。在CentOS中,可以通过以下命令安装绑定驱动:
yum install ifenslave
2.创建ifcfg-bond0文件
接下来需要创建bond0配置文件,这可以在/etc/sysconfig/network-scripts/
文件夹中完成。可以使用以下命令创建ifcfg-bond0
文件:
vi /etc/sysconfig/network-scripts/ifcfg-bond0
在文件中添加以下配置:
DEVICE=bond0
BONDING_OPTS=\"mode=1 miimon=100\"
BOOTPROTO=static
IPADDR=X.X.X.X
NETMASK=X.X.X.X
ONBOOT=yes
配置文件参数定义
DEVICE
:绑定网卡的网络名称,这里是“bond0”。
BONDING_OPTS
:查看命令bonding
可以得到支持的绑定方式。
BOOTPROTO
:网络的启动协议,这里是静态。
IPADDR
:本地网络接口的IP地址。
NETMASK
:本地网络接口的子网掩码。
ONBOOT
:设置是否在系统启动时自动启用网络接口。
绑定网卡到bond0
修改/etc/sysconfig/network-scripts/ifcfg-eth0
和/etc/sysconfig/network-scripts/ifcfg-eth1
文件,文件中的内容有所不同,但将以下内容添加到两个文件中:
MASTER= bond0
SLAVE=yes
保存修改并重启网络服务
保存ifcfg-bond0
,ifcfg-eth0
和ifcfg-eth1
文件后,可以通过以下命令重启网络服务:
systemctl restart network
结论
在配置bond0网卡之后,服务器的网络传输速度将提高,这对于需要高速传输数据和企业级应用程序的服务器来说是非常重要的。在绑定多张网卡时,我们应该选择一种合适的绑定方式,并了解所需的硬件设备。
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至p@qq.com 举报,一经查实,本站将立刻删除。